22问答网
所有问题
当前搜索:
函数式编程和面向对象
自学Python,提示invalid syntax
答:
提示invalid syntaxd 原因:该问题是语法错误,说明语句不合规则,首要考虑的原因就是python2和python3的语法是否弄混,python3要求print后要加括号.解决办法:注意python2和python3的语法区别,加上括号即可。Syntax(语法),在计算机科学中指一种程序设计
语言
的拼写和文法。计算机是仅当你以精确的形式输入...
Java
语言
的优势
答:
如果说传统的过程
式编程
语言是以过程为中心以算法为驱动的话,面向对象的编程语言则是以对象为中心以消息为驱动。用公式表示,过程式编程语言为:程序=算法+数据;
面向对象编程语言
为:程序=对象+消息。 所有面向对象编程语言都支持三个概念:封装、多态性和继承,Java也不例外。现实世界中的对象均有属性和行为,映射到...
编程
思想基础:
面向对象和面向
过程的区别
答:
二、特点不同 1、
面向对象
:每个对象都有自身唯一的标识,通过这种标识,可找到相应的对象。在对象的整个生命期中,标识都不改变,不同的对象不能有相同的标识。2、面向过程:分析出解决问题所需要的步骤,然后用
函数
把这些步骤一步一步实现,使用的时候一个一个依次调用就可以了。三、功能不同 1、...
c++和C
语言
的区别?
答:
C
语言与
C++的区别有很多:1,全新的程序程序思维,C语言是面向过程的,而C++是
面向对象
的。2,C语言有标准的
函数
库,它们松散的,只是把功能相同的函数放在一个头文件中;而C++对于大多数的函数都是有集成的很紧密,特别是C语言中没有的C++中的API是对Window系统的大多数API有机的组合,是一个...
面向对象
的程序设计
语言
有哪些?
答:
大小由之。4、java:Java是一门
面向对象编程语言
,不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此Java语言具有功能强大和简单易用两个特征。Java语言作为静态面向对象编程语言的代表,极好地实现了面向对象理论,允许程序员以优雅的思维方式进行复杂的编程。
举例说明
面向对象编程和
结构化编程的优缺点
答:
1、
面向对象
原本要解决什么(或者说有什么优良特性)似乎很简单,但实际又很不简单:面向对象三要素封装、继承、多态 (警告:事实上,从业界如此总结出这面向对象三要素的一刹那开始,就已经开始犯错了!)。封装:封装的意义,在于明确标识出允许外部使用的所有成员
函数和
数据项,或者叫接口。有了封装,...
面向对象
的三个基本特征分别是什么?
答:
2、继承:
面向对象编程
(OOP)
语言
的一个主要功能就是“继承”。继承是指这样一种能力:它可以使用现有类的所有功能,并在无需重新编写原来的类的情况下对这些功能进行扩展。3、多态:多态性(polymorphisn)是允许你将父对象设置成为和一个或更多的他的子对象相等的技术,赋值之后,父对象就可以根据...
js怎么写2秒后再刷新当前页面
答:
设置定时2秒后执行刷新。 setTimeout(function(){//使用setTimeout()方法设定定时2000毫秒 window.location.reload();//页面刷新 },2000);
web前端培训课程都学习什么内容?
答:
【web前端培训课程】都学习HTML5+CSS3、JS基础语法与表达式、移动进阶之高效开发、小程序与app开发,具体如下:一:HTML5+CSS3在第一阶段学习常用标签/属性,进行结构搭建、学习VSCode开发工具使用,能创建简单网页、浮动与定位核心知识,灵活运用实现网页布局、BFC规范和浏览器差异等。二:JS基础语法与...
为什么print()会提示invalid syntax?
答:
提示invalid syntaxd 原因:该问题是语法错误,说明语句不合规则,首要考虑的原因就是python2和python3的语法是否弄混,python3要求print后要加括号.解决办法:注意python2和python3的语法区别,加上括号即可。Syntax(语法),在计算机科学中指一种程序设计
语言
的拼写和文法。计算机是仅当你以精确的形式输入...
棣栭〉
<涓婁竴椤
2
3
4
5
6
7
8
9
10
11
涓嬩竴椤
灏鹃〉
其他人还搜